2. Difficulties Of Recycling Solar Panels



It is extensively accepted that recycling solar panels has many ecological benefits, nevertheless, it is additionally real that the procedure isn't without its difficulties. Yet what exactly are these challenges? https://www.renewableenergymagazine.com/emily-newton/four-amazing-benefits-of-adding-parking-lot-20221215 's explore additionally.



Among the greatest concerns with reusing solar panels is the complexity of the job itself. It can be difficult to break down the various parts, such as glass and steel, to be reused independently. Furthermore, photovoltaic panel makers often have a mix of products utilized in their products which makes sorting them a lot more difficult. In addition, there are safety and security and health risks entailed with dealing with damaged glass or breathing in fumes from thawing parts.

An additional essential difficulty related to reusing solar panels is price. Many countries do not have enough facilities or resources to effectively recycle these things which causes higher expenses for organizations trying to do so. In addition, due to the specific nature of recycling solar panels, this can produce an economic burden on companies attempting to remain certified with laws. Ultimately, these expenses could be given to customers making it tough for them to afford renewable energy resources.

3. Approaches For Recycling Solar Panels



As the world strives for a much more sustainable future, recycling solar panels is a significantly popular task. In the middle of this expanding rate of interest, nonetheless, we should consider the approaches that remain in area to make it feasible.

To begin with, lots of business have implemented a 'take-back' system wherein old or broken solar panels can be accumulated and sent out to their particular manufacturing facilities for reusing. By doing this, the products have the ability to be reused in the construction of new items. Additionally, some municipalities have even started supplying rewards for individuals desiring to reuse their photovoltaic panels; this can range from tax obligation breaks to totally free shipping prices.

Additionally, innovation has ended up being progressively sophisticated when it comes to reusing photovoltaic panels-- with specialised machines efficient in separating out all the different parts within them. For example, by utilizing AI-powered robot arms, these equipments can remove valuable products such as copper and aluminium while likewise taking care of hazardous waste safely.
